    Lastly, Harry Potter did it right for a few reasons:

    1) It was an infinite loop - everything that happened in the movie/book happened as a result of them traveling through time to cause it to happen. Then, at the end, it's revealed that they traveled through time to save lives in the first place. It was them traveling through time before that allowed them to travel through time in the future, so it was a closed loop. No paradoxes.

    2) They didn't use time travel as an excuse for everything. Up until the end they didn't even realize that was what was causing all of the events to unfold.

    3) They didn't have time travel present and then not properly use it - in other words, they knew they had to go back in time and it never happened out of sequence. The future never really changed because the future that happened was always supposed to happen.

    That's how Heroes' time travel should have been, but they've screwed it all up.
